Two Atoms that are isotopes of another must have the same number of what

Respuesta :

ayyyyyooo
ayyyyyooo ayyyyyooo
  • 15-12-2020

Answer:

Two atoms which are isotopes of one another must have a different number of neutrons. Isotopes are defined as atoms of the same element which have the same numbers of protons i.e. atomic number remains the same, but has different numbers of neutrons.
